Benefit of adding Cureety Techcare telemonitoring to usual care during injectable anticancer treatment
Study description
A prospective, randomized, open-label, multicentric study designed to evaluate the effectiveness of standard of care with Cureety (RPM), compared to the standard of care alone OPTIMA program, to reduce the number of outgoing telephone calls during the first 8 weeks of intravenous treatment. The OPTIMA oncology program streamlines chemotherapy prescription and preparation through a pre-treatment consultation or call, and blood tests conducted 2 days before the patient's infusion.
Key results
127 patients in RPM group • 65 in control group (OPTIMA).
Reduction of the total number of calls in RPM group (mean diff = -1.25 • p < 0.001), and specifically the number of call for visit preparation (mean diff = -2.7 • p < 0.001).
Increase number of calls for inter-cycles toxicities (mean diff = +1.48 • p < 0.001) → Optimized patient management.
